MOHERMAN, Rolla E.
Husband of Alta M. KLINGEMAN – m. 1906

Son of Robert "Fred" and Theeta Fear (Witherstine) Foulk Moherman
b. 14 Sep 1881 in Jackson Twp., Mahoning Co. OH
d. 13 July 1957 in Warren, Trumbull County, Ohio, aged 75y 9m 29d
Burial – 17 July 1957 in Jackson Twp. Cemetery, Section IV Row 13, North Jackson, Mahoning Co. OH

Mahoning Dispatch, Fri, July 19, 1957
"Rolla E. Moherman, 75, of Warren, died Saturday evening in the Trumbull Memorial hospital, following a two year illness. Born in Jackson township, Sept. 14, 1881, he was a son of Mr. and Mrs. Fred Moherman, and had resided in Warren for 45 years. A retired carpenter, Mr. Moherman was a member of the Reformed church at North Jackson. Surviving are his wife, the former Alta M. Klingeman, whom he married in 1906; two sons, Paul L. of Warren and Richard D. of Los Angeles, Calif.; a daughter, Mrs. Burton Curtis of East Palestine and three grandchildren. Funeral services were held Wednesday afternoon in Warren and burial made in the North Jackson cemetery."
